Cheesy Ground Beef and Rice Casserole

This cheesy ground beef and rice casserole is an easy, family-friendly dinner packed with seasoned beef, veggies, creamy rice, and plenty of melty cheese.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 40 minutes
Total Time 1 hour
Course dinner, Main Course
Cuisine American
Servings 8

Ingredients
  

  • 2  bell peppers, cubed – Use any color you like. I love using two different colors to make the casserole a little more colorful.
  • 1  large onion, diced – A yellow or white onion works perfectly.
  • 6 garlic cloves, minced – I know six sounds like a lot, but trust me! Fresh garlic adds so much flavor.
  • 1 lb ground beef 
  • 15 oz can crushed tomatoes – This adds tomato flavor and helps keep the rice moist without making the casserole taste like tomato sauce.
  • 2 cups  uncooked white rice – Use regular long grain white rice
  • 3 1.2 cups  beef broth – The uncooked rice absorbs the chicken broth as it bakes, giving you flavorful, tender rice. Chicken broth can also be used.
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ream – Just enough to make the rice rich and creamy
  • 1 tsp  garlic powder
  • 1 tsp  onion powder
  • 1 tsp salt, plus more to taste
  • 1/2 tsp  black pepper
  • 1 tsp paprika
  • 1 tsp  Mrs. Dash seasoning
  • 2 cups shredded cheese – Use your favorite melting cheese. Cheddar, Colby Jack, Monterey Jack, or a combination of cheeses would all work well.
  • Fresh cilantro or fresh parsley – Either one is great for adding a little freshness before serving.

Instructions
 

  • Preheat your oven to 400°F.
    I like to combine all the seasonings into a small bowl. 
  • Heat a large skillet over medium heat. Add the diced onion and cook for about a minute, stirring occasionally.
    Add the cubed bell peppers and half of the seasonings. Give everything a good stir and continue cooking until the peppers and onion begin to soften.
    Add the minced garlic toward the end. I like adding fresh garlic last because it only needs a short amount of time to cook. Let it cook just until fragrant, then transfer the vegetable mixture to a large bowl.
  • Return the same skillet to the stove, then add 1 tablespoon of oil, add in the ground beef and the remaining half of the seasonings. Cook over medium-high heat, breaking the meat apart as it cooks. Continue cooking until the beef is browned and cooked through. If necessary, drain off any excess grease.
    Add the cooked ground beef to the large bowl with the peppers and onions.
  • Now add the crushed tomatoes, uncooked rice, broth, and heavy cream. Mix everything really well, making sure the rice and beef mixture are evenly distributed.
    Transfer everything to a large casserole dish and spread it into an even layer.
    Cover and bake at 400°F for about 35 minutes, or until the rice is cooked and tender. Depending on your oven and the type of white rice you use, the cooking time can vary slightly, so check the rice before adding your cheese.
    Once the rice is tender, sprinkle 2 cups of shredded cheese evenly over the top.
    Place the casserole back into the oven just until the cheese melts and becomes bubbly and golden. Let the casserole cool for a few minutes before serving, then sprinkle with fresh cilantro or parsley.
